A PEAT BOG UNDER THREAT INTRODUCTION Gors Lwyd (Grid Ref. SN8575) is a peatland at the watershed of the rivers Elan and Ystwyth, at an altitude of 386m, which is likely to be submerged or at least badly damaged if plans for the enlargement of the Craig Goch reservoir in the Elan Valley are implemented. Each year the Mires Research Group, a specialist section of the British Ecological Society, has a field meeting somewhere in Britain to study a peatland*In September 1975 it was decided that the threat to Gors Lwyd was sufficient to justify a broad, if not detailed, study of this peatland, perhaps one of the best of its type still remaining in mid-Wales. A small basin in the northern part of the site has already been studied and the stratigraphical and pollen analysis results published (Moore and Chater, 1969; Moore, 1970). The work of the Mires Research Group fell into two sections, one to look at surface vegetation in relation to water chemistry and the other to look at the stratigraphy of the peat and the underlying shape of the whole site. The plant species found in the first part of this investigation are given in Table 1. Plant Species at Gors Lwyd Numbers following names show percentage of quadrats containing that species.
